Mushroom substrate can be put in a number of containers. For commercial growers, it’s commonest to pack substrate into massive distinct plastic luggage. Residence growers might get ready mushroom substrate jars, from mason jars or other tiny containers, or pack substrate into buckets.

A mushroom substrate is a material that gives the required nutrients for mushroom mycelium to grow and make mushrooms. It serves as the foundation for the mushroom cultivation course of action. The substrate could be made from a range of natural elements, which includes straw, sawdust, Wooden chips, and agricultural by-items.
Soon after making ready your substrate, the following action is inoculation. This is the process of introducing mushroom spawn or spores in the substrate. The mycelium will start to colonize the substrate, breaking down the material and utilizing it being a food stuff source to develop.
